AI summary

Samtex Fashions reported zero revenue from operations for both standalone and consolidated results for FY2026, with the company confirming no business activity during the year. Standalone net loss was INR 31.18 lakhs (vs INR 29.23 lakhs loss prior year), while consolidated net loss was INR 37.09 lakhs. The auditor issued a Qualified Opinion citing: (1) non-recognition of impairment and non-charging of depreciation on PPE, (2) unconfirmed long-outstanding trade receivables of INR 587.34 lakhs (standalone) and INR 28,477.48 lakhs (consolidated) without ECL provision, and (3) material uncertainty about going concern. The company has negative net worth, current liabilities exceeding current assets, and has not undertaken any manufacturing activity since 2019. Additionally, the company faces Rs 807.46 crore corporate guarantee liability for subsidiary SSA International Ltd, SARFAESI notices, DRT proceedings, and willful defaulter status declared by IDBI Bank.

Likely market impact

This is a severely distressed company with multiple audit qualifications, negative net worth, and serious legal/financial challenges. The stock faces extreme risk as the auditors explicitly doubt the company's ability to continue as a going concern. Shareholders should be aware of potential total loss of investment value.
